>> I retained the logic for special case of vfio-pci. At the moment
>> (according to my knowledge) there are no other DPDK modules with this
>> name replacement.
>>
>> I checked few example Linux modules and if a module is named with dash,
>> it's being replaced to underscore. The modprobe(8) tool can accept both
>> names as interchangeable (with dash and underscore).
>>
>> Would you like to make it a general rule and replace all dashes with
>> underscores?
